Страницы

Поиск по вопросам

суббота, 16 марта 2019 г.

Получение представления для сочетания клавиш

Допустим, у меня в приложении есть контрол, имеющий какой-либо KeyStroke. И у него автоматически выставляется ToolTip в зависимости от системы. Например, на Windows это текст вида Ctrl+Shift+Z, а на MacOS - ⌘⇧Z. Как получить эту строку для заданного сочетания клавиш? P.S. Интересует получение данной строки как с помощью AWT (или Swing).


Ответ

Смотрие в сторону KeyEvent.getKeyModifiersText, KeyEvent.getKeyText и KeyEvent.getKeyModifiersExText

Комментариев нет:

Отправить комментарий